Cheeseburger Soup is a cozy, creamy dish packed with all the flavors you love in a cheeseburger. With ground beef, cheese, and tasty veggies, it’s a warm hug in a bowl!
You’ll love how easy it is to whip up this hearty soup. Just throw everything in a pot and let it simmer. Who needs a cookout when you can enjoy this indoors? 😄
I often serve it with crusty bread for a complete meal. Plus, you can throw in your favorite toppings like pickles or extra cheese—yum! Enjoy this tasty treat anytime!
Key Ingredients & Substitutions
Ground Beef: I like using lean ground beef for this recipe to keep it less greasy. If you’re looking for a lighter option, turkey or chicken can work too! Just remember, they may cook faster.
Bacon: The crispy bacon adds a nice crunch and flavor. If you want to skip the bacon, try using turkey bacon or even some smoked paprika to add that delicious smoky taste.
Potatoes: Russet potatoes are great for this soup, but you can use Yukon Golds for a creamier texture. If you’re low-carb, cauliflower can be a fantastic substitute too.
Cheddar Cheese: Sharp cheddar gives the best flavor. If you prefer something milder, go for mild cheddar or even mozzarella. Vegan cheese options can also be used for a dairy-free version.
What’s the Secret to a Creamy Cheese Soup?
To get that perfect creamy texture, you’ll want to add the milk and flour mixture gradually. Here’s how to do it:
- In a bowl, whisk the flour into the milk until smooth—this helps prevent lumps.
- Once the soup is simmering, slowly add the milk mixture while stirring constantly. This ensures even distribution through the soup.
- Allow it to simmer for a few more minutes to thicken, but don’t let it boil, or the creaminess can break down.
Taking these steps seriously will give you that lovely creamy consistency in your cheeseburger soup!

How to Make Delicious Cheeseburger Soup
Ingredients You’ll Need:
Main Ingredients:
- 1 lb ground beef
- 4 slices bacon, diced
- 1 small onion, diced
- 1 cup celery, diced
- 3 cloves garlic, minced
- 4 cups peeled and diced potatoes (about 2 medium potatoes)
- 4 cups beef broth
- 2 cups whole milk or half-and-half
- 2 cups sharp cheddar cheese, shredded
- 1/4 cup all-purpose flour
- 1 teaspoon Worcestershire sauce
- Salt and pepper, to taste
Optional Garnishes:
- Cooked bacon pieces
- Extra shredded cheddar cheese
- Chopped parsley
How Much Time Will You Need?
This recipe will take about 10-15 minutes to prep, and then 30-40 minutes to cook. In total, you should be ready to enjoy your comforting Cheeseburger Soup in about an hour!
Step-by-Step Instructions:
1. Cook the Bacon:
In a large pot or Dutch oven, cook the diced bacon over medium heat until it turns crispy. Once it’s cooked, remove the bacon with a slotted spoon and set it aside, but leave the delicious bacon fat in the pot—it adds great flavor!
2. Brown the Beef:
Next, add the ground beef to the pot with the bacon fat. Use a spatula to break it up as it cooks until it’s fully browned. If there’s too much fat after cooking, feel free to drain some out to keep it from being overly greasy.
3. Sauté the Veggies:
Now, it’s time to add the diced onion, celery, and minced garlic. Stir everything together and cook for about 3-4 minutes until the veggies have softened nicely.
4. Add Potatoes and Broth:
Stir in the diced potatoes and pour in the beef broth. Bring the mixture to a boil, then reduce the heat to a simmer. Let it cook for about 15-20 minutes until the potatoes are nice and tender.
5. Make it Creamy:
In a separate bowl, whisk the flour into the milk or half-and-half until it’s completely smooth. Gradually add this mixture into the soup, stirring constantly. This helps to avoid any lumps!
6. Thicken the Soup:
Keep the soup on a gentle simmer for another 5-10 minutes. You’ll notice it thickening up nicely.
7. Add Cheese and Flavor:
Lower the heat to prevent boiling, then stir in the shredded cheddar cheese and Worcestershire sauce until the cheese melts and creates a creamy consistency. Taste your soup and season it with salt and pepper to your liking.
8. Serve and Enjoy:
Serve your Cheeseburger Soup hot! Top it with the reserved bacon pieces, extra cheddar cheese, and a sprinkle of chopped parsley for a fresh finish. Enjoy every comforting spoonful!
Dig into this rich and creamy Cheeseburger Soup for a taste that’s just like your favorite cheeseburger but in a cozy bowl!

Can I Use Ground Turkey or Chicken Instead of Beef?
Absolutely! Ground turkey or chicken can be great substitutes for a lighter option. Just make sure to cook it thoroughly until it’s no longer pink, and adjust seasoning as needed since these meats can be milder compared to beef.
How Can I Make This Soup Dairy-Free?
To make a dairy-free version, replace the whole milk or half-and-half with a dairy-free milk alternative, like almond milk or coconut milk. Use a dairy-free cheese to keep that cheesy flavor while catering to dietary needs!
What Can I Substitute for Potatoes?
If you’re looking to reduce carbs, you can use cauliflower. Just chop it into small florets and add it at the same time as the broth. It will soften and blend beautifully into the soup!
How to Store Leftovers?
Store any leftovers in an airtight container in the fridge for up to 3 days. When reheating, do it gently on the stovetop or in the microwave, adding a splash of broth or milk to restore creaminess if needed.